Organizing speech content clearly and maintaining eye contact are essential techniques for effective public speaking in JROTC. Clear organization helps the audience follow your message logically, making it easier for them to understand and retain the information being presented. When a speaker structures their content wisely, it creates a roadmap for the listeners, highlighting key points and transitions that enhance comprehension.

Maintaining eye contact is equally important as it fosters a connection between the speaker and the audience. This engagement shows confidence and encourages the audience to remain attentive and involved in the presentation. Eye contact can also help gauge the audience's reactions, allowing the speaker to adjust their delivery accordingly.

In contrast, speaking softly, avoiding eye contact, reading directly from notes, and using vague language hinder effective communication. These behaviors may leave the audience confused or disengaged, undermining the intention of the speech.
